How To Fix LTR2_ANA2081 - None customer selection specified, use default selection


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LTR2_ANA2 - LTR2 Analysis Messages

  • Message number: 081

  • Message text: None customer selection specified, use default selection

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message LTR2_ANA2081 - None customer selection specified, use default selection ?

    The SAP error message LTR2_ANA2081 indicates that there is no customer selection specified in the context of a report or analysis, and the system is prompting you to use a default selection instead. This error typically arises in the context of SAP Logistics or SAP Analytics, where customer-specific data is required for processing.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Customer Selection: The primary cause of this error is that the user has not specified any customer selection criteria in the report or analysis they are trying to execute.
    2. Default Settings: The system is set to use default settings, which may not be appropriate for the analysis you are trying to perform.
    3.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the report or the data source that is supposed to provide customer information.

    Solution:

    1. Specify Customer Selection:

      • When running the report or analysis, ensure that you fill in the customer selection fields. This may involve entering specific customer IDs, names, or other relevant criteria.
    2. Check Default Settings:

      • Review the default settings in the report or analysis configuration. If the defaults are not suitable, consider adjusting them to better fit your needs.
    3. Review Report Configuration:

      • If you have access to the report configuration, check if the customer selection fields are correctly set up. Ensure that they are not set to mandatory if they should be optional.
    4.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to the SAP documentation or help files related to the specific report or analysis you are using. There may be specific instructions on how to set customer selections.
    5. Contact Support:

      • If the issue persists after trying the above solutions,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with an SAP expert who can provide further assistance.
